Fallston had won three straight at home, but on Wednesday they bumped up to 4-3 to make it four. They narrowly escaped with a victory as the squad sidled past the North Harford Hawks 7-5. This was payback for the Cougars, who suffered a 3-2 defeat the last time these two teams met.
Fallston got a great performance from Ryan Cullison as he struck out six batters over 5.2 innings while giving up just two earned (and two unearned) runs off five hits.

On the hitting side, Garrett Kersch was excellent, going a perfect 2-for-2 with four RBI and one run. Those four RBI gave him a new career-high. Zach Loewe was another key player, going 1-for-3 with two runs and one stolen base.
As for North Harford, their loss was their first in the region, dropping their region record down to 5-1 and their overall record down to 6-2. For those keeping track at home, that's the closest defeat they have suffered since April 22, 2025.
On North Harford's side, Colin Kight was cooking despite his team's loss, going 2-for-3 with one triple, one stolen base, and one double. Kight has been hot recently, having posted at least one stolen base the last four times he's played. Another player making a difference was Nate Lynn, who went a perfect 2-for-2 with one stolen base and two RBI.
Coming up, Fallston will face off against Gerstell Academy on Friday. As for North Harford, they will square off against Rising Sun at 3:15 p.m. on Friday.
